Market Snapshot: Automatic Document Feeder Market Size and Growth

In 2024, the automatic document feeder (ADF) market reached USD 1.57 billion, with growth projected to USD 1.67 billion in 2025. A robust CAGR of 6.62% highlights strong market momentum, fueled by organizational investments in ADF devices to meet expanding document management needs. This expansion is propelled by the critical demand for efficient scanning, copying, and data management across industries. As the adoption of digital-first business processes accelerates, ADF solutions are becoming integral to streamlining workflows and supporting scalable, adaptable operations for enterprises around the world.

Scope & Segmentation of the Automatic Document Feeder Market

This report offers executive-ready segmentation and actionable insights designed to guide strategic planning across technologies, product lines, and geographic regions.

  • Product Types: Integrated automatic document feeders for multifunction environments, and standalone ADF scanners designed for high-throughput or specialized uses.
  • Feed Types: Flatbed, roller, and sheetfed models built to handle varying document formats and page shapes, addressing workflows that include both standard and irregular documents.
  • Technology: Single-pass and dual-pass scanning mechanisms enhance duplex scanning and image quality for diverse business requirements.
  • Paper Handling Capacity: ADFs available in low, medium, and high-capacity options, enabling tailored solutions for small teams or large enterprise document centers.
  • Speed Range: Devices categorized by throughput—under 20 pages per minute (PPM), 20–40 PPM, and above 40 PPM—to meet time-sensitive and routine processing demands.
  • Connectivity Type: Offers wired and wireless options, supporting flexible remote and mobile document workflows through technologies such as Bluetooth and Wi-Fi.
  • Applications: Capabilities cover copying, faxing, printing, scanning, advanced archiving, and workflow integration, thus addressing evolving enterprise demands.
  • End-Use Industries: Adoption across banking and financial services, education, government, healthcare, manufacturing, office settings, retail, transportation, and logistics, each influencing technology preference and investment focus.
  • Regional Coverage: Granular analysis provided for the Americas, Europe, Middle East & Africa, and Asia-Pacific, addressing country- and sub-regional-level dynamics.

Tariff Impact and Strategic Response

New United States tariffs affecting imported ADF components and finished products have contributed to increased supply chain complexity and cost pressures. In response, leading producers are optimizing sourcing strategies, investing in near-shoring, expanding domestic assembly presence, and broadening their product portfolios to maintain market competitiveness and sustain innovation.
